I am working on migrating a SQL 2008 SSIS package to SQL 2012. After upgrading and loading the package, I scheduled it.

The job fails and the error says

'Package execution on IS Server failed. Execution ID: 20, Execution Status:4. To view the details for the execution, right-click on the Integration Services Catalog, and open the [All Executions] report'

When I open the report as instructed, it shows me zeroes for all columns - 0 failed, 0 running, 0 succeeded, 0 others. I clicked on the filter and it is applying only a date; changing the date to encompass the past year and next month, nothing appears.

This is my first experience with SQL 2012 and the Integration Services reports.

Am I missing something to find the execution details?

What happened to me was an issue with the date filters. SSMS was defaulting the date filters of the All Executions report to end at the current date, 2016-11-28. However, in the server's time zone, the date was 2016-11-29. Apparently even though these filters appear to default based on your desktop's time zone, they are applied using the server's time zone. I was able to get the missing executions to appear by changing the date filter to include 'tomorrow'.
